- Plan and manage the full life cycle of 24*7 cloud-based support projects.
- Manage key customer discussions/meetings from customer premise as and when required
- Ensure round the clock handover of critical issues are managed and critical issues are being worked upon round the clock
- Lead projects/change requests across AWS, Azure, or GCP environments, ensuring alignment with customer goals, timelines, and budgets.
- Triage by classifying support tickets based on their nature and urgency.
- Develop and maintain detailed project plans for new project or change request, schedules, and timelines; manage changes proactively to scope, resources, or timelines.
- Coordinate and align efforts between technical delivery teams, partner team, customers, and third-party vendors.
- Ensure all projects/change requests are delivered on time, within scope, and within budget, while meeting high standards of quality and customer satisfaction.
- Apply structured execution methodologies, leveraging Agile practices, planning tools, and strong risk and issue management.
- Continuous communication and collaboration across all stakeholders.
- Publish weekly KPIs and metrics with leaders; Promptly escalate risks and blockers to leadership when needed.
- Maintain accurate and comprehensive project documentation throughout the project lifecycle E.g. Master RCA/Anomalies document for recurring issues, User Guide document.
- Manage team conflict, take ownership on managing team’s roster in balanced way and rotation is managed well to avoid personal grievance
- Align with organization policies and compliance and ensure its followed
- Work with customer technical team and our team closely for production instance stabilization plan w.r.t stability for long term.

Skills Required
- 6–10 years of experience with project management methodologies such as Agile, Scrum, and Waterfall
- At least 2 years of experience in cloud-based projects
-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and problem-solving skills
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ering, information technology, or a related field
- Project management certification such as PMP, Certified Scrum Master, or Professional Scrum Master
- Cloud certification such as A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ner or Azure Fundamentals
- Energy sector domain knowledge or experience with energy sector projects
- Master’s degree
